Investigative Support

Central to the security of any nation is the ability of its law enforcement agencies to conduct effective criminal investigations. This requires a unique set of skills to systematically uncover and objectively assess evidence gathered from myriad sources - from crime scenes to witness and subject interviews to computer databases. The investigative support programs offered by The Soufan Group are precisely structured to develop the critical skills necessary to conduct meticulous, comprehensive, and successful investigations into a wide array of crimes. Taught by experienced federal, state, and local investigators, the range of available courses includes:

General Investigation teaches the basic field techniques of evidence collection and crime scene processing along with interviewing and report-writing skills.

Crime Scene Investigation covers the vital skill sets required to systematically process, investigate, and clear the scene of a crime, including data recording, chain-of-custody, and offender profiling

Criminal Management Investigation prepares officers and agents to effectively manage a complex investigation, supervise an investigative team, prioritize and pursue leads, and maintain comprehensive files

Computer Investigation offers an intensive exploration into the world of computer crime and develops expertise in data recovery, locating and securing digital evidence, and supporting prosecutions

Forensics provides the knowledge and practical ability to recognize, evaluate, extract, process, and safeguard evidence a variety of crime scenes

Forensic Sketch Artist presents the tools and techniques to assist in the identification of unidentified persons, to include witness interviews, computerized sketching, perceptual skills, and working with investigators.
